HCE Project Python language Distributed Tasks Manager Application, Distributed Crawler Application and client API bindings.
2.0.0-chaika
Hierarchical Cluster Engine Python language binding
EventObjects.py
Go to the documentation of this file.
1
'''
2
@package: dc
3
@author scorp
4
@link: http://hierarchical-cluster-engine.com/
5
@copyright: Copyright © 2013-2014 IOIX Ukraine
6
@license: http://hierarchical-cluster-engine.com/license/
7
@since: 0.1
8
'''
9
10
from
app.Utils
import
JsonSerializable
11
import
app.Utils
as
Utils
# pylint: disable=F0401
12
13
14
logger = Utils.MPLogger().
getLogger
()
15
16
17
class
CustomRequest
(
JsonSerializable
):
18
19
# #constructor
20
# initialize fields
21
# @param rid - request id
22
# @param query - custom query string
23
# @param dbName - db name
24
#
25
SQL_BY_INDEX = 0
26
SQL_BY_NAME = 1
27
28
def
__init__
(self, rid, query, dbName):
29
super(CustomRequest, self).
__init__
()
30
self.
rid
= rid
31
self.
query
= query
32
self.
dbName
= dbName
33
self.
includeFieldsNames
= self.
SQL_BY_INDEX
34
35
36
37
class
CustomResponse
(
JsonSerializable
):
38
39
# #constructor
40
# initialize fields
41
# @param rid - request id
42
# @param query - custom query string
43
# @param dbName - db name
44
#
45
def
__init__
(self, rid, query, dbName):
46
super(CustomResponse, self).
__init__
()
47
self.
rid
= rid
48
self.
query
= query
49
self.
dbName
= dbName
50
self.
result
= tuple()
51
self.
errString
=
None
dbi.EventObjects.CustomResponse
Definition:
EventObjects.py:37
ftests.ftest_ContentEvaluator.getLogger
def getLogger()
Definition:
ftest_ContentEvaluator.py:16
dbi.EventObjects.CustomResponse.errString
errString
Definition:
EventObjects.py:51
dbi.EventObjects.CustomRequest.dbName
dbName
Definition:
EventObjects.py:32
dbi.EventObjects.CustomRequest
Definition:
EventObjects.py:17
app.Utils.JsonSerializable
Definition:
Utils.py:104
dbi.EventObjects.CustomRequest.rid
rid
Definition:
EventObjects.py:30
dbi.EventObjects.CustomResponse.query
query
Definition:
EventObjects.py:48
app.Utils
Definition:
Utils.py:1
dbi.EventObjects.CustomResponse.dbName
dbName
Definition:
EventObjects.py:49
dbi.EventObjects.CustomRequest.query
query
Definition:
EventObjects.py:31
dbi.EventObjects.CustomResponse.result
result
Definition:
EventObjects.py:50
dbi.EventObjects.CustomRequest.includeFieldsNames
includeFieldsNames
Definition:
EventObjects.py:33
dbi.EventObjects.CustomResponse.rid
rid
Definition:
EventObjects.py:47
dbi.EventObjects.CustomRequest.SQL_BY_INDEX
int SQL_BY_INDEX
Definition:
EventObjects.py:25
dbi.EventObjects.CustomResponse.__init__
def __init__(self, rid, query, dbName)
Definition:
EventObjects.py:45
dbi.EventObjects.CustomRequest.__init__
def __init__(self, rid, query, dbName)
Definition:
EventObjects.py:28
sources
hce
dbi
EventObjects.py
Generated on Fri Nov 24 2017 18:53:55 for HCE Project Python language Distributed Tasks Manager Application, Distributed Crawler Application and client API bindings. by
1.8.13